Jnanpith Awardee C Narayana Reddy Passes Away

Renowned Telugu poet and writer Cingireddi Narayana Reddy has passed away. In 1992, Reddy was awarded the country’s third-highest civilian honour, Padma Vibhushan.

In 1997, he was nominated to the Upper House of Parliament. In 1998, he received the prestigious Jnanpith award in 1988 for his poetic work Visvambara which got translated into three other languages.

Reddy has also written several songs for Telugu movies. Narayana Reddy was born in Karimnagar district of Andhra Pradesh on July 29, 1931.

He had obtained his MA and PhD in Telugu literature from Osmania University. Previously, he had also worked as a professor of the University.
